  • Chemokines (chemotactic cytokines) are positively charged polypeptides with highly conserved cysteine (C) residues within the N-terminal sequence, classifying them as 'C', 'CC', 'CXC' or 'CX3C' types (102, 143). (pancreapedia.org)
  • In the context of AP, the most extensively investigated chemokines are CC-ligand 2 (CCL2, also known as monocyte chemoattractant protein-1 or MCP-1), CXC-ligand 1 (CXCL1, also known as cytokine-induced neutrophil chemoattractant or CINC in rat and keratinocyte cytokine or KC in mouse), and CXC-ligand 2 (CXCL2, also known as macrophage inflammatory protein 2-alpha or MIP2a). (pancreapedia.org)

  • In contrast, on monocytes and, indeed, more-differentiated macrophages, TNF is a much more potent activator than IL-1. (biomedcentral.com)
  • Clearly, this difference reflects receptor distribution, as monocytes have very few IL-1 receptors [ 8 ] but relatively abundant p55 and p75 TNF receptors. (biomedcentral.com)
